2160 John Crane 2160 sheet gasket is a compressed sheet with a synthetic fiber base and butadiene acrylonitrile binder. This material has excellent sealability and exhibits good creep resistance.
4160 John Crane 4160 sheet gasket is a compressed sheet with synthetic fiber base and styrene butadiene rubber binder. This material has excellent sealability, good anti-stick properties, and exhibits good creep resistance.
